Donald Trump hints at which Premier League team he supports
Talking to journalist and Arsenal fan Piers Morgan back in 2018, Trump was presented with a Gunners shirt with his name on the back. Trump’s son, Barron, is a fan of Arsenal, with Morgan looking to make the President a supporter of the north London side.
However, Trump admitted that his allegiance lies with another Premier League giant, Manchester United.
“That’s beautiful, I have a son who does love this sport,” Trump said in response to the shirt.
Morgan joked: “And he loves Arsenal, right? Are you an Arsenal fan, too?”
Trump responded: “Not particularly, no. I have a friend who owns Manchester United.”
That “friend” in question appears to be Edward Glazer, co-owner of the Red Devils. In fact, it is claimed that Glazer donated £45,000 during Trump’s first ever US presidential campaign.
